You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@struts.apache.org by dw...@apache.org on 2002/01/15 04:57:40 UTC
cvs commit: jakarta-struts/contrib/validator/web/example/WEB-INF struts-config.xml validation.xml web.xml
dwinterfeldt 02/01/14 19:57:40
Modified: contrib/validator INSTALL
contrib/validator/dist struts-validator.tld
contrib/validator/web/example/WEB-INF struts-config.xml
validation.xml web.xml
Removed: contrib/validator build-test.xml
Log:
Package names have changed and dependencies have been added on the Commons Validator.
Revision Changes Path
1.2 +5 -4 jakarta-struts/contrib/validator/INSTALL
Index: INSTALL
===================================================================
RCS file: /home/cvs/jakarta-struts/contrib/validator/INSTALL,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- INSTALL 7 Jul 2001 05:31:18 -0000 1.1
+++ INSTALL 15 Jan 2002 03:57:40 -0000 1.2
@@ -1,13 +1,14 @@
Struts Validator
==================
-The Struts Validator Jar (dist/Struts_Validator-{date}.jar) and version 1.2 of the
-Jakarta Regular Expression Package (http://jakarta.apache.org/regexp) needs to be
-added to /WEB-INF/lib.
+The Struts Validator Jar (dist/struts-validator.jar),
+Jakarta Commons Validator (http://jakarta.apache.org/commons) ,
+and version 1.2 of the Jakarta Regular Expression Package
+(http://jakarta.apache.org/regexp) needs to be added to /WEB-INF/lib.
This needs to be added to the web.xml file to load the ValidatorServlet.
<servlet>
<servlet-name>validator</servlet-name>
- <servlet-class>com.wintecinc.struts.action.ValidatorServlet</servlet-class>
+ <servlet-class>org.apache.struts.action.ValidatorServlet</servlet-class>
<init-param>
<param-name>config</param-name>
<param-value>/WEB-INF/validation.xml</param-value>
1.2 +1 -101 jakarta-struts/contrib/validator/dist/struts-validator.tld
Index: struts-validator.tld
===================================================================
RCS file: /home/cvs/jakarta-struts/contrib/validator/dist/struts-validator.tld,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- struts-validator.tld 9 Jul 2001 02:48:50 -0000 1.1
+++ struts-validator.tld 15 Jan 2002 03:57:40 -0000 1.2
@@ -7,7 +7,7 @@
<shortname>Struts Form Validator Tags</shortname>
<tag>
<name>javascript</name>
- <tagclass>com.wintecinc.struts.taglib.html.JavascriptValidatorTag</tagclass>
+ <tagclass>org.apache.struts.validator.taglib.html.JavascriptValidatorTag</tagclass>
<attribute>
<name>formName</name>
<required>false</required>
@@ -35,106 +35,6 @@
</attribute>
<attribute>
<name>src</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- </tag>
- <tag>
- <name>errors</name>
- <tagclass>com.wintecinc.struts.taglib.html.ErrorsTag</tagclass>
- <teiclass>com.wintecinc.struts.taglib.html.ErrorsTei</teiclass>
- <bodycontent>JSP</bodycontent>
- <attribute>
- <name>id</name>
- <required>true</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>bundle</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>locale</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>name</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>property</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>header</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>footer</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- </tag>
- <tag>
- <name>errorsExist</name>
- <tagclass>com.wintecinc.struts.taglib.html.ErrorsExistTag</tagclass>
- <attribute>
- <name>name</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>property</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- </tag>
- <tag>
- <name>messages</name>
- <tagclass>com.wintecinc.struts.taglib.html.MessagesTag</tagclass>
- <teiclass>com.wintecinc.struts.taglib.html.MessagesTei</teiclass>
- <bodycontent>JSP</bodycontent>
- <attribute>
- <name>id</name>
- <required>true</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>bundle</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>locale</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>name</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>header</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- <attribute>
- <name>footer</name>
- <required>false</required>
- <rtexprvalue>true</rtexprvalue>
- </attribute>
- </tag>
- <tag>
- <name>messagesExist</name>
- <tagclass>com.wintecinc.struts.taglib.html.MessagesExistTag</tagclass>
- <attribute>
- <name>name</name>
<required>false</required>
<rtexprvalue>true</rtexprvalue>
</attribute>
1.2 +8 -8 jakarta-struts/contrib/validator/web/example/WEB-INF/struts-config.xml
Index: struts-config.xml
===================================================================
RCS file: /home/cvs/jakarta-struts/contrib/validator/web/example/WEB-INF/struts-config.xml,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- struts-config.xml 9 Jul 2001 02:30:58 -0000 1.1
+++ struts-config.xml 15 Jan 2002 03:57:40 -0000 1.2
@@ -23,19 +23,19 @@
<!-- Registration form bean -->
<form-bean name="registrationForm"
- type="com.wintecinc.struts.example.validator.RegistrationForm"/>
+ type="org.apache.struts.validator.example.RegistrationForm"/>
<!-- Multi-Part Registration form bean -->
<form-bean name="multiRegistrationForm"
- type="com.wintecinc.struts.example.validator.RegistrationForm"/>
+ type="org.apache.struts.validator.example.RegistrationForm"/>
<!-- Type form bean -->
<form-bean name="typeForm"
- type="com.wintecinc.struts.example.validator.TypeForm"/>
+ type="org.apache.struts.validator.example.TypeForm"/>
<!-- JavaScript Type form bean -->
<form-bean name="jsTypeForm"
- type="com.wintecinc.struts.example.validator.TypeForm"/>
+ type="org.apache.struts.validator.example.TypeForm"/>
</form-beans>
@@ -49,7 +49,7 @@
<!-- Registration Form -->
<action path="/registration"
- type="com.wintecinc.struts.example.validator.RegistrationAction"
+ type="org.apache.struts.validator.example.RegistrationAction"
name="registrationForm"
scope="request"
validate="true"
@@ -59,7 +59,7 @@
<!-- Multi-Part Registration Form -->
<action path="/multiRegistration"
- type="com.wintecinc.struts.example.validator.MultiRegistrationAction"
+ type="org.apache.struts.validator.example.MultiRegistrationAction"
name="multiRegistrationForm"
scope="request"
validate="false">
@@ -70,7 +70,7 @@
<!-- Type Form -->
<action path="/type"
- type="com.wintecinc.struts.example.validator.TypeAction"
+ type="org.apache.struts.validator.example.TypeAction"
name="typeForm"
scope="request"
validate="true"
@@ -80,7 +80,7 @@
<!-- JavaScript Type Form -->
<action path="/jsType"
- type="com.wintecinc.struts.example.validator.TypeAction"
+ type="org.apache.struts.validator.example.TypeAction"
name="jsTypeForm"
scope="request"
validate="true"
1.5 +14 -14 jakarta-struts/contrib/validator/web/example/WEB-INF/validation.xml
Index: validation.xml
===================================================================
RCS file: /home/cvs/jakarta-struts/contrib/validator/web/example/WEB-INF/validation.xml,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-r1.4 -r1.5
--- validation.xml 17 Oct 2001 20:37:05 -0000 1.4
+++ validation.xml 15 Jan 2002 03:57:40 -0000 1.5
@@ -4,7 +4,7 @@
<constant name="zip" value="^\d{5}\d*$" />
<validator name="required"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ateRequired"
msg="errors.required">
<javascript><![CDATA[
@@ -37,7 +37,7 @@
</validator>
<validator name="minlength"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ateMinLength"
depends="required"
msg="errors.minlength">
@@ -75,7 +75,7 @@
</validator>
<validator name="maxlength"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ateMaxLength"
depends="required"
msg="errors.maxlength">
@@ -113,7 +113,7 @@
</validator>
<validator name="mask"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ateMask"
depends="required"
msg="errors.invalid">
@@ -158,7 +158,7 @@
</validator>
<validator name="byte"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ateByte"
depends="required"
msg="errors.byte"
@@ -197,7 +197,7 @@
</validator>
<validator name="short"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ateShort"
depends="required"
msg="errors.short"
@@ -236,7 +236,7 @@
</validator>
<validator name="integer"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ateInteger"
depends="required"
msg="errors.integer"
@@ -275,13 +275,13 @@
</validator>
<validator name="long"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ateLong"
depends="required"
msg="errors.long"
/>
<validator name="float"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ateFloat"
depends="required"
msg="errors.float"
@@ -320,13 +320,13 @@
</validator>
<validator name="double"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ateDouble"
depends="required"
msg="errors.double"/>
<validator name="date"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ateDate"
depends="required"
msg="errors.date"
@@ -493,7 +493,7 @@
</validator>
<validator name="range"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ateRange"
depends="required,integer"
msg="errors.range">
@@ -533,7 +533,7 @@
</validator>
<validator name="creditCard"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ateCreditCard"
depends="required"
msg="errors.creditcard">
@@ -602,7 +602,7 @@
</validator>
<validator name="email"
- classname="com.wintecinc.struts.validation.StrutsValidator"
+ classname="org.apache.struts.validator.util.StrutsValidator"
method="validateEmail"
depends="required"
msg="errors.email">
1.2 +2 -2 jakarta-struts/contrib/validator/web/example/WEB-INF/web.xml
Index: web.xml
===================================================================
RCS file: /home/cvs/jakarta-struts/contrib/validator/web/example/WEB-INF/web.xml,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-r1.1 -r1.2
--- web.xml 9 Jul 2001 02:30:58 -0000 1.1
+++ web.xml 15 Jan 2002 03:57:40 -0000 1.2
@@ -8,7 +8,7 @@
<!-- Validator Initialization Servlet Configuration -->
<servlet>
<servlet-name>validator</servlet-name>
- <servlet-class>com.wintecinc.struts.action.ValidatorServlet</servlet-class>
+ <servlet-class>org.apache.struts.validator.action.ValidatorServlet</servlet-class>
<init-param>
<param-name>config</param-name>
<param-value>/WEB-INF/validation.xml</param-value>
@@ -26,7 +26,7 @@
<servlet-class>org.apache.struts.action.ActionServlet</servlet-class>
<init-param>
<param-name>application</param-name>
- <param-value>com.wintecinc.struts.example.validator.ApplicationResources</param-value>
+ <param-value>org.apache.struts.validator.example.ApplicationResources</param-value>
</init-param>
<init-param>
<param-name>config</param-name>
--
To unsubscribe, e-mail: <ma...@jakarta.apache.org>
For additional commands, e-mail: <ma...@jakarta.apache.org>